Understanding the Basics of Unlocks

The unlock system in GTA Online is all about progress. The game wants you to start small and grow into a powerful criminal mastermind (or a law-abiding citizen, if that’s your style!). Most items, vehicles, missions, and features aren’t available right away. Instead, you have to reach certain levels, finish missions, or spend your hard-earned in-game cash to gain access to them. Let’s break down the most common ways things become available:

  • Leveling Up: This is probably the most important way to get stuff. As you complete jobs, participate in races, and do other activities, your character gains experience points (RP). Collecting enough RP makes you level up, which is how you get access to more powerful guns, better cars, more fun missions, and new character customization options.
  • Completing Missions and Heists: Many parts of the game open up when you finish specific missions or heists (big, complicated jobs). These are often connected to the game’s storyline and introduce you to new characters and locations. Doing these missions not only opens up content but also gives you a lot of money to spend.
  • Spending Money: Some items, such as businesses, fancy apartments, and powerful vehicles, become available only when you have enough money to buy them. So, making money in GTA Online is as important as leveling up.

Missions and Story Progress Unlocks

Beyond just leveling, the main story missions and other specific jobs are very important for accessing different parts of the game. Let’s look at some examples:

Heist Unlocks

Heists are special missions that require multiple players and a lot of coordination. Each heist has a specific set of requirements before you can start it. Completing a heist unlocks access to the next one in the series, often with improved payouts and new vehicles and items.

  • The Fleeca Job: This is the first heist most players will complete. It introduces the heist gameplay and is a great way to earn money.
  • The Prison Break: This heist is a bit tougher and requires more teamwork, but it is also more rewarding.
  • The Humane Labs Raid: Another more difficult heist. This is where you get to use more advanced weapons.
  • Series A Funding: This heist has you dealing with some very strange business operations. It can be quite profitable.
  • The Pacific Standard Job: The most rewarding of the original heists, completing this means you’re well on your way to the top.
  • The Doomsday Heist: One of the most complex and challenging heists which requires owning a facility.
  • The Diamond Casino Heist: A more advanced heist which lets you choose different approaches, with different payouts.
  • The Cayo Perico Heist: A heist that allows you to play it solo, with a massive payout if you plan it out well.

Business Unlocks

Once you have enough money, you can purchase businesses which, in turn, allow you to generate passive income, complete business-related tasks, and access more content. For example:

  • Motorcycle Clubs: Let you purchase biker businesses that generate income but require you to perform resupply and sales missions.
  • CEO Offices: Allow you to complete special cargo missions and vehicle cargo missions, while also opening up additional content.
  • Bunkers: Open up research and weapons manufacturing tasks, along with the ability to modify and research powerful weapons and vehicles.
  • Nightclubs: Allows you to manage a club and let your various businesses contribute to your overall income, and access more vehicles.

Money-Based Unlocks: The Power of the Dollar

Having money in GTA Online is like having keys to new doors. The more you earn, the more things you can access. Here are some of the important unlocks tied to your bank balance:

Property Purchases

You will need to purchase different properties like apartments, garages, and business locations before unlocking more gameplay.

  • Apartments: Provide a safe house, allow you to start heists, and offer other unique perks. The more expensive apartments tend to offer more storage, while also being closer to things you need.
  • Garages: Allow you to store your cars and bikes.
  • Hangars: Allow you to store and modify aircraft.
  • Facilities: Required to begin the Doomsday Heist, they are useful and give you access to more powerful vehicles.
  • Businesses: As mentioned before, purchasing businesses lets you engage in different money-making activities and open up new missions and items.

Vehicle Purchases

You can buy different vehicles from various websites on your in-game phone. The better the vehicle, the more it tends to cost. Unlocking certain military vehicles, planes, and weaponized vehicles require you to be at a certain level or to have specific businesses.

  • Sports Cars and Supercars: Fast cars that are great for racing, as well as looking good while cruising.
  • Armored Vehicles: These vehicles can withstand a lot of damage and are useful in missions and freeroam.
  • Military Vehicles: These vehicles can be used in combat or in specific missions.
  • Aircraft: Helicopters and planes are good for travel and some have weapons.

Weapon Purchases

You can buy weapons at Ammu-Nation, but the better weapons become available as you level up. You can also buy attachments to improve your weapons’ stats. Some powerful weapons require you to have completed a particular mission or purchased a specific type of business.

Cosmetic Items and Customizations

You can buy clothing, tattoos, hairstyles, and other customizations that make your character unique. The more expensive cosmetic items usually become available once you have reached a certain level or completed certain missions. Some special customization options are locked behind business ownership.

Specific Business Unlock Paths

To provide more clarity on how these interweave, here’s an example of how business unlocks often work:

  1. Start with the CEO Office: Purchase a CEO office, this unlocks special cargo missions and vehicle cargo missions.
  2. Purchase a Vehicle Warehouse: Now you can begin completing vehicle cargo missions.
  3. Purchase a Bunker: Now you can begin resupplying and performing research in your bunker.
  4. Purchase a Motorcycle Club: With your MC you can buy a biker business, such as a coke lab.
  5. Purchase a Nightclub: Now you can manage the nightclub and connect it to your other businesses.

The order that you purchase these items may affect the flow of your gameplay. Experiment with different approaches to find what works best for you.
